Creating an Automator populate event
Use the following procedure to create an Automator populate event.
Before you begin
To create an Automator populate event
Run the Automator application.The application will be found in the Start Menu underBMC AMI Capacity Management.
- Select File > New.
A new script window is displayed. - Select Edit > Add Target Database/Group.
- From the list, select the ODBC Database from which you want to populate the data to, and click OK.
- Select Edit > Add Event > Populate.
- Browse or enter a location on the local machine to which you want to transfer the VIS files.
Click OK.
Your script should now look as follows:If you run the Automator populate event now and you have VIS files in the specified folder, they should populate to the designated database.
